Output 81e883ab6edafdac77e94237353bd6f02df6eb78ae3ac5d5430a4003c7ecd44a:0

value
1691615
script pubkey
OP_0 OP_PUSHBYTES_20 7b597691f6aac4d557db8963f34bfcf2334237da
address
bc1q0dvhdy0k4tzd247m393lxjlu7ge5yd76ua3r0a
transaction
81e883ab6edafdac77e94237353bd6f02df6eb78ae3ac5d5430a4003c7ecd44a